Holy Shit! I was named in Dennis Thatcher's will!
I'm getting 950,000 pounds sterling!

here's the email I just got from the free email account that the Catholic Priest who is, for whatever reason, helping the solicitor, is using to send me an email in which I am listed as a bcc, on an email address account that isn't even linked to my name at all.

I'm sure it's legitimate, given the circumstances I just outlined! I know if I were looking for someone named in the will of the husband of the prime minister, I'd have a clergyman NOT from the Church of England, and preferably a clergyman from outside the country, send a bcc email from a free email account to an email account that nowhere in the world could anyone possibly form a connection between the account and the person. Wouldn't you?

Obviously, sending a mail letter from the lawyer's office, or a direct personal phone call would be fucking stupid. No, better to have the Priest send blind emails.
